How old are your kids?



Contact the Turtle people. Sorry dont know their proper name or number but I am sure somebody will.

Its not a day out but they arrange good sightings for nesting turtles round about end of May/June time and they also release baby turtles in the wild later on in the year and you can go and watch that. All kids love that, of all ages.



Kantara Castle is a great place to visit for all ages, but watch your footing.



Going towards Famagusta is Bowling, paintballing and go-karting.



Going north up the pan handle are some great kid friendly beaches either for the day, or to hire over night for a real adventure.



I was told that there are some good riding stables your way that are open during the cooler months and you can go on some great days out on horseback.

The turtle project is great, they will be starting night watches after the first week of june, they are located at alagadi beach, there is an old house that they use as a bass. People are welcome to go down and have a chat.

I will be posting when the night watches start, so you can go and watch the turtles lay, then later in the season you can watch the hatching.

Hi Alie, they are a really nice bunch down at the Goat shed Thats the name of their base, pop down any time and talked to Robin he is the guy who runs things down there. you may be able to help out with the patrols on the beach.

The Goat shed is near the first bay at Alagadi, follow the signs for St Kathleens. Its not hard to miss it has a gaint green Turtle painted on the side of the house.

I will keep everyone posted when the night watches start.
